Obermayer Adds Bankruptcy Attorney Alicia M. Sandoval

8/24/17

Alicia M. Sandoval

Obermayer Rebmann Maxwell & Hippel LLP adds Alicia M. Sandoval to the firm’s Creditors' Rights, Bankruptcy and Financial Reorganization Department. She will be based in Obermayer’s Philadelphia office.

Sandoval represents businesses in need of restructuring, reorganization, and liquidation. Representations include secured creditors in Chapter 7, 11 and 13 bankruptcy matters, including adversary proceedings, claim objections, stay relief motions, objections to Chapter 11 and 13 plans, loan workouts and analysis of regulatory compliance. Prior to joining the firm, she was an attorney at a Southern New Jersey Law firm in their bankruptcy and commercial litigation departments. Prior to that she was at a Philadelphia firm where she prosecuted and defended personal injury litigation, contract disputes, and workers compensation claims in Pennsylvania and New Jersey.

Sandoval is the firm’s sixth lateral hire this summer. Obermayer is focusing on growing in its outer offices as well as in targeted practice areas. Earlier this summer partner Andrew Kasmen and attorney Remi Schwartz started in the Conshohocken office. Kasmen focuses on real estate and corporate law and Schwartz is in the family law department. Additionally, partner Michael Hooper joined in the firm’s Pittsburgh office where he will focus his practice on commercial transactions and large mineral title projects. And finally, health law attorney Arielle Lusardi and litigation attorney Andrew Stoll started in the Philadelphia office. The firm plans to continue its steady growth.
